Inspect panels for corrosion, loose connections, or overheating.
Check circuit labels and schedules.
Verify emergency lighting and exit sign functionality.
Inspect wiring for wear or damage.
Check switchgear cleanliness and ventilation.
Tighten loose connections.
Inspect breakers, fuses, and safety interlocks.
Inspect fixtures for damage or malfunction.
Replace burnt-out bulbs or LEDs.
Test controls, including motion sensors.
Test outlets for voltage and grounding.
Inspect for damage.
Check GFCI functionality.
Test backup generators.
Inspect UPS system batteries.
Verify emergency power outlets.
Inspect HVAC electrical components.
Check thermostat settings.
Note noise or vibration issues.
Test ground fault protection.
Verify AFCI operation.
Check RCD functionality.
Document maintenance, repairs, replacements.
Update equipment inventory.
Note future upgrade recommendations.
